Heads of department: Q3 planning must reflect the write-down of obsolete Lumidex cartridge stock at the Ferndale warehouse. Finance has booked the adjustment; no further action needed on valuation. Procurement will revise reorder thresholds, and Operations will schedule disposal by quarter-end. Plan your budgets accordingly. The related strategic note for your planning is set out below.

management briefing: Project Ulavan slips by two quarters because of the staffing delay.

## Ticket: Shard migration blocked on signature failure

For the weekly sync: the Murkvale profile-store resharding job died last night because the shard-map artifact failed its signature check on nodes 7 through 12. Looks like those nodes still trust the pre-migration keyring, so everything signed after the cutover gets rejected. Quick fix is to push the current trust bundle and re-run the migrator — halting mid-reshard is safe, nothing was half-moved. The signer we're rolling out everywhere is below.

rollout seal: bky4_x7Gc

Welcome aboard! While Hollis & Tarn's main building gets its long-overdue facelift, we're all camped out at the Wrenmoor Annexe across the courtyard. Visitors need to sign in at the folding desk just inside the side door — yes, the one with the hand-written sign, we know it's not glamorous. Please walk your guests in and out yourself, as the temporary layout confuses everyone. Staff can come and go through the side door at any time using the pass code below.

badge for yajep-tawip: bdg-UBYAH-39947

## Authentication

This README accompanies the postmortem for the Harrowfen stale-cache incident, in which invalidation messages were dropped and clients served week-old pricing. The replay tooling in `tools/cache-replay` reconstructs the event timeline from the Fenwick audit log. Reviewers should note the tool requires read-only access to the audit store; it cannot mutate cache state. Authentication uses a scoped service credential rotated every 30 days. For this review cycle, use the credential provided below.

API key for yahig-tadup: kto7_ubizbYm

### Rollout: Flagstone Framework

When ramping a flag via Flagstone, hold at 5% for one hour and watch the Bellgrave error dashboard. If error rates stay flat, proceed in 25% increments. Roll back immediately on any elevated crash signal. All rollout actions are recorded against the deploy, identified by the trace token below.

trace token, fafog-kageg: htk4_98e6